An employee at a Walmart in Upstate New York has been accused of stealing more than $10,000 from the store.
WHAM reports David Ashworth was arrested after his cash register was $10,047 short last Thursday at the Walmart in Victor, N.Y. The Ontario County Sheriff’s Office said investigators determined he removed the money during his work shift and hid a money bag with the cash inside.
Ashworth, 51, allegedly retrieved the pouch at the end of his shift, concealed it on his body, and left the store with the cash, deputies said.
WHEC reports Ashworth was arrested Monday night and charged with grand larceny in the third degree. He was released Tuesday after his arraignment and is due in Victor Town Court at a later date.
